The Orchestra of the Age of Enlightenment's trademark diversity is in full evidence in its 2010/11 season. Whether your passion is Wagner on period instruments, discovering the music of JS Bach’s son CPE Bach or enjoying a musical tour of Baroque Italy, the season contains something for every musical taste, all played with the Orchestra’s trademark vitality and verve. Running alongside early evening concerts, The Night Shift is also back, presenting classical music in a contemporary, late-night atmosphere, and there’s also a full programme of events designed to let you get closer to the music through pre-concert talks, post-show Q&As, a study day and Insight Clubs.

The Night Shift, London's unique classical night, took place at the atmospheric Wilton's Music Hall for the very first time in August 2010. The concert featured the Orchestra of the Age of Enlightenment playing music by Purcell and Handel, with support from Nathan 'Flutebox' Lee. The Night Shift takes place four to five times a year - for full information visit oae.co.uk/thenightshift.
